Betting Odds Explained

Understanding wagering odds is essential for us as players, as they show the probability of an event occurring and influence our possible returns. In conventional betting, there are various odds formats: fractional, decimal, and moneyline, each having a unique purpose. Fractional odds, popular in the UK, indicate prospective profit relative to the stake. Decimal odds give a straightforward calculation of returns, while moneyline odds are more typical in the US, highlighting the profit in relation to a $100 wager. Understanding these odds formats helps us understand betting terminology and assess value bets successfully. By studying the odds, we can make informed decisions that align with our entire betting strategy, ultimately boosting our grasp of the betting landscape.

Risk Management Strategies

While engaging in conventional betting, using effective risk management strategies is crucial for safeguarding our bankroll and maximizing long-term profitability. One key aspect is bankroll management, where we establish the amount of money we can bear to lose without impacting our finances. This involves setting limits and committing to them religiously. Additionally, conducting thorough risk analysis enables us to assess possible outcomes and make educated decisions. We should evaluate past betting trends, comprehend the odds, and modify our stakes accordingly. By spreading our bets and preventing chasing losses, we create a equitable approach that can help reduce risks. Ultimately, these strategies enable us to relish betting sensibly while guaranteeing our bankroll is safeguarded against considerable losses.

Game Mechanics Overview

The mechanics of the Aviator game depend on a fine balance between risk and reward, captivating players with the thrill of gambling while luring them with potential rewards. The game design encourages player engagement by offering escalating multipliers that players can cash out on. Each round involves a risk-reward analysis; waiting too long may lead to losing all gains, while premature cash-outs reduce potential payouts. Statistically, we can see that lower multipliers provide consistency in gains, while higher multipliers yield higher rewards but with increased risk. This interplay is vital, as it influences player behavior and decision-making, mirroring the real-world dynamics of betting through calculated risks.
